Chocolate is derived from the cocoa bean, which grows on the cacao tree or Theobroma cacao, a tropical plant that originated in Central America. It is thought that between 1500 BC-400 BC, the Olmec Indians began to cultivate cocoa beans as a domestic crop. Eventually the ancient Mayans, who are renowned as drinkers of chocolate, set up cacao tree plantations in South America. Today, the cocoa plant is grown in tropical regions world wide. The tree produces large, football shaped pods that contain between 30 - 50 cocoa beans.

When the Organic cocoa bean is processed - cocoa liqueur and cocoa butter are produced. These ingredients are turned into dark chocolate bars by adding a bit of Organic sugar, typically raw cane sugar. And that is your basic organic dark chocolate.

Of course, we do not usually stop there. You will find many different organic chocolates and chocolate bars that contain other ingredients besides dark chocolate and sugar. Organic orange oil, vanilla and other flavorings are added. You will find organic dark chocolate ingredients that include chili powder, nuts and berries, and even other types of candies such as toffee. As long as these additional ingredients are organic, you still have organic chocolate.

It is the high content of cacao solids that make chocolate into dark chocolate. When milk is added to the mixture the result is called milk chocolate. While some may prefer the taste of milk chocolate to dark chocolate , it should be noted that the antioxidant properties of dark chocolate are much greater than other forms of chocolate.
